In Stock Genuine Neca Ninja Turtles Insect Man Female Journalist Fly Man Foot Soldier Casey Has Paint Defect 7-Inch Doll Gift

In Stock Genuine Neca Ninja Turtles Insect Man Female Journalist Fly Man Foot Soldier Casey Has Paint Defect 7-Inch Doll Gift

Aliexpress UK